Hekmat Amiri, a civil activist from Dehgolan, was sentenced to imprisonment.

According to received reports, Hekmat Amiri, a civil activist from Dehgolan, was sentenced to 42 months in prison by the First Branch of the Revolutionary Court in Dehgolan, presided over by Judge Rostami Ahqar.

According to this report, Mr. Amiri was sentenced to 6 months of imprisonment and 36 months of suspended imprisonment on charges of "propaganda against the regime and collaboration with groups and organizations opposed to the regime." The verdict was communicated to him in early August 2024.

The court session addressing Hekmat Amiri's charges took place in April 2024 at the Revolutionary Court in Dehgolan.
